Order Dismissing Case
TEXT ORDER. The parties have filed a Notice of Settlement. (Doc. 71). Accordingly, this action is DISMISSED without prejudice subject to the right of any party within sixty days to file another paper per Local Rule 3.09(b) or to move to reopen the case, which motion the Court would liberally grant. If no such papers have been filed within this sixty-day period, the dismissal of this case shall be with prejudice. The Clerk of Court is now DIRECTED to deny all pending motions as moot, terminate any deadlines, and close the case, subject to reopening if the parties file an appropriate motion within the sixty-day deadline set forth above. Signed by Judge John L. Badalamenti on 8/27/2026. (CAR)
